Output 171c4667d88320037b81c05f10090d3796d5c1339aa53307acc5e555c5968170:13

value
2999992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5721162fc34aaf7c76efc08b25accfe59f3df64 OP_EQUAL
address
3M9cVysmiC29cGfpvB7MePDNzsprA4LHDe
transaction
171c4667d88320037b81c05f10090d3796d5c1339aa53307acc5e555c5968170
spent
true